Superior to its wool and synthetic sisters, the cashmere jumper is a winter favourite for it soft touch and insulating qualities. Warmer yet lighter than the aforementioned fabrics, cashmere will help you retain heel on colder days, without overheating you when it warms up. The higher price on cashmere is due to its harvesting requirements. Harder to source than typical wool, cashmere must be harvested from cashmere goats once a year, meaning that the fabric is naturally more expensive than its wool or cotton counterparts. Although the knitwear might feel delicate, cashmere fibres can be hardy so, if you look after yours well, it’ll be in your wardrobe for a very, very long time.
